What is vulcanized rubber insulated cable?
Matthew Elliott Rubber has been used as cable insulation and sheathing material long before other insulation such as PVC and PE can to be commonly applied. All rubbers are thermoset or cross-linked by a process referred to as Vulcanisation. As thermoset materials they do not soften or melt when exposed to heat.
What is a PILC cable?
The types of power cables used are paper-insulated lead covered (PILC) cables and cross-linked polyethylene (XLPE) cables. The PILC cables are manufactured by using layers of paper impregnated with a compound mineral oil as insulating medium, both as individual core and overall insulation.
What is 2.5 electric cable used for?
2.5mm Twin and Earth is commonly used as indoor domestic cable. The most common use for this type of cable is for circuits that provide power to sockets. It is made up of two cores and an earth core which must be covered with the identifying green and yellow sleeve when installed.
What is TRS wire?
The letters TRS stand for Tip, Ring, and Sleeve, and refer to the parts of the jack plug that the different conductors are connected to. A TRS cable has three conductors vs the two on a standard guitar cable. A guitar cable is a TS, or Tip Sleeve cable. TS and TRS Jack Plugs.

Where is PILC cable used?
PILC (Paper Insulated, Lead Covered ) Cable is used in power transmission. Conductors are wrapped in oil impregnated paper which is surrounded by a lead jacket. This cable construction was common for underground power transmission but has largely been replaced by polymer insulated cabling in the last half century.
What is 4mm twin and earth cable used for?
4mm twin & earth is a triple insulated core which contains a bare earth, and a brown live and a blue neutral sheathed conductor. It is commonly used for indoor domestic wiring projects including lighting, low supply hobs and cookers where an increased amount of power is required.
